Detroit Pistons star earns NBA weekly honor for an outstanding week


NEW YORK, NY –

Detroit Pistons guard and former Oklahoma State standout, Cade Cunningham, was named the NBA’s Eastern Conference Player of the Week on Monday. It’s the second time in his career he’s taken home the honor, with the first occurring on December 23rd, 2024. Cunningham averaged 31 points, 9.8 assists, 3.3 rebounds in a 4-0 week for the Pistons.

Cunningham scored a season-high 31 points in Detroit’s 125-107 win over the Brooklyn Nets on Friday. He also chipped in 10 assists in the victory. Two days later, he recorded a double-double, scoring 26 points and dishing out 11 assists in the 111-108 win over the Philadelphia 76ers.

The Pistons are currently in first place in the Eastern Conference with an 8-2 record. It’s the team’s best start in 20 years.
